As for the hack to remove the WirelessMng icon.....this is a bit more simple and direct, although almost the same,

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Services\WirelessMgr
DWord: Keep Set Value: 0 0x0(0)
Hmmm... Something strange is going on. This simply doesn't work in my case. Not sure why. I also tried adding a ShowIcon DWORD value (set to 0) and that doesn't help either. As I mentioned previously, I've done this several times in the past without problem.

I notice there is a key within the WirelessMgr key called "LaunchApplet", which I don't recall seeing before. I wonder if my problem is related to that key. Does everyone else have that key?
